Well I tried the demo (non patron) and I liked it enough...



Graphics - Beautiful. Of course ive seen better but for an early demo, it’s very visually appealing imo. A lot of details and a pretty big world. Good runtime with minor lags. You can adjust your screen size and other things but I didn’t mess around too much with that.

Music/Voice acting - I rarely have music on in games so I can’t comment much in this area. I did have the volume on low so I can tell you that there is voice acting. The FeMC’s voice was high pitched at times.

Load time - Fairly fast. No major complaints. Does occasionally lag but not too much. When moving to a new area it can occasionally take a bit to load.

Controls - Could be better. You have to use the arrow keys to get around. Not sure if there is a way to change that but it didn’t appear to be. If you don’t use a mouse/touch pad, the camera angle will randomly change on its own. Which is annoying and can cause minor motion sickness. Doesn’t have xbox controller support.

Game play - Honestly there isn’t much to do yet. Without spoilers, you’re given a task right away but not much clues as to how to complete it. The only human characters you get to see in this demo (so far) is the MC’s father and sibling. If you speak to your father a second time then he’ll give you hints on how to complete the task but not much. Luckily there is a map and it’ll tell you (eventually) the general area of where to go but with the world as big as it is, it doesn’t help much. There is no “fast travel” so it can take a while to get from area to area. You’re mc can run but only for a limited time before the run meter needs to recharge (similar to Yokai Watch or My Time in Portia).

Fishing - Easy, fun. Gives you good instructions when you first fish. Not sure what game I can compare it to...

Glitches/Annoyances - I was playing the game for a few hours so this might be my fault but after completing the task first given, I saw a marked area on my map. I go there and talk to the character but my game semi froze. The time still went by but I couldn’t move anymore, couldn’t talk to them, pressed the map and menu buttons but nothing. Gave it a few rl minutes to see if it was just lagging but nope. Had to turn the whole game off.

Which brings me to my major disappointment:

In this game you can quick save, which brings you to the main menu so you can turn your game off. However that save is deleted the moment you reload. The only way to permanently save is to go you your characters house and save there but the MC’s House is NOT available in the non-patron demo. So you can only quick save.

I quick saved a few times (because I had to go to work or whatever) and able to load where I left off when I got back to the game. As I mentioned, it deletes that save the moment you load it. It wasn’t a big deal until my file froze. Since I couldn’t quick save, I had to shut the game down without saving. When I tried to restart the game, I no longer had a file so I would’ve have to start the whole game all over again from the beginning :/ All the work I had done was gone. :roll:



Good news (sorta): is that if you ARE a patron, then your MC’s house is available and you can have a permanent save file. Silver lining I guess?
I’ve played one other game that has the same quick save option but it still annoys me :shock:

All in all, it looks like it could be a good game when it’s complete. However, unless you become a patron (which you’d have to pay your desired amount monthly until you cancel), I’d say don’t try the open general public demo. Unless you really want to get a feel for the game.
